Is Centrum Performance Tablets Gluten Free?
Why it's a maybe for gluten free
- modified starch
- starch
modified starch
Dietitian noteStarch is the carbohydrate of a plant whereas gluten is the protein. Starch can be derived from a variety of grains, and starch from a gluten-containing grain can be refined enough to be gluten free. However, it's very difficult to separate the starch from a protein of the plant, so unless the label lists a gluten-free grain or states that the product is gluten-free, we recommend you verify with the manufacturer.

What is a Gluten Free diet?
A gluten-free diet excludes all foods containing gluten, a protein found in wheat, barley, rye, and their derivatives. It's essential for people with celiac disease, gluten intolerance, or wheat allergy, as consuming gluten can trigger inflammation and digestive issues. Common gluten-containing foods include bread, pasta, cereals, and baked goods, though many gluten-free alternatives now exist using rice, corn, or almond flour. Beyond medical necessity, some people choose a gluten-free lifestyle for perceived health benefits, though experts emphasize the importance of maintaining a balanced diet rich in fiber, vitamins, and minerals when eliminating gluten-containing grains.
